Choisya ternata, commonly known as Mexican Orange Blossom, is a lush, evergreen shrub prized for its glossy green foliage and clusters of fragrant white flowers that appear in spring and often again in autumn. Thriving in full sun to part shade and well-drained soil, it’s perfect for NZ gardens as a hedge, border, or feature plant. This hardy shrub is drought-tolerant once established, low-maintenance, and adds year-round structure, colour, and fragrance to outdoor spaces.

Olearia paniculata Kaikoura is an evergreen, NZ native shrub featuring leathery, dark green leaves with a wavy margin. The foliage is held densely and complemented with mildly fragrant, white flowers through summer as it grows to 3 m tall and 2 m wide. Olearia Kaikoura is commonly included in a mixed or native planting, trimmed into a hedge, or used as a backdrop for smaller plants.
